SUMMARY
A strong and pungent curried chicken, enveloped in soft wholemeal bread and baked into desired toastiness.

METHOD
1. Preheat oven to 400 degrees F or 204 degrees C.
2.. Remove crusts (sides) from bread; cover with a damp towel or plastic wrap to keep soft. Make crumbs from crusts by putting a few at a time into a blender.
3. Combine 3 tablespoons bread crumbs with chicken, peanuts, green onion, 5-spice powder, curry powder, honey, pepper, soy sauce, and parsley; mix well.
4. Roll bread slices very thin with a rolling pin. Cut each square in half, place a teaspoon of chicken mixture on each piece. Brush edges of bread with egg yolk; fold in half to form a square. Pinch to seal, trimming if necessary.
5. Bake for 15 minutes or until golden brown. May be served with mustard sauce. Makes 36 squares.
